Dear Visitors,
Rita and Doug Swan, the Founders of CHILD, Inc., are now deceased: Doug in 2018 and Rita in 2022. Below you will find their message to you written when the organization formally closed its doors in 2017.

Children’s Healthcare Is a Legal Duty (CHILD), Inc.

is no longer an active tax-exempt charity. There is, however, a new successor non-profit organization called CHILD USA operating out of the University of Pennsylvania.  It was formed with the original CHILD’s encouragement and support and is dedicated to ending child abuse and neglect through evidence-based research resulting in enlightened law and public policy. 

This original CHILD website, www.childrenshealthcare.org, continues however as an archive for CHILD’s many endeavors from 1983 to 2017 to protect children from harmful religious and cultural practices—especially faith-based medical neglect—through public education, research, legal action, and a limited amount of lobbying.  A second webpage, designed to educate the public about the situation in Idaho, IdahoChildren.org , will also continue to be available online for an indefinite period.  It is our intention and hope that both sites will be valuable resources for current and future advocates working to establish healthcare for all children as a legal duty.

We are deeply grateful to those who supported our child advocacy work during the past 34 years.

Rita and Douglas Swan, Co-founders
